install_vertica
, a powerful shell script provided by Verticathat configures a cluster of hosts that can be used to create a database. The script does a number of checks to catch common Linux misconfigurations. It checks the connectivity and bandwidth characteristics of the communication links among the cluster machines and verifies other pre-requisites.You must be logged in as root to use install_vertica
and you must run install_vertica
for all installations, including upgrades and single-node installations.
